လက်ရှိတည်နေရာ: ပင်မစာမျက်နှာ> နောက်ဆုံးရဆောင်းပါးများစာရင်း> PHP တွင် variable အမျိုးအစားများကိုရယူနိုင်သောလုပ်ဆောင်ချက်များကိုအသေးစိတ်ရှင်းပြချက်နှင့်အသုံးပြုမှုဥပမာများ

PHP တွင် variable အမျိုးအစားများကိုရယူနိုင်သောလုပ်ဆောင်ချက်များကိုအသေးစိတ်ရှင်းပြချက်နှင့်အသုံးပြုမှုဥပမာများ

M66 2025-07-22

PHP တွင် variable တစ်ခု၏ဒေတာအမျိုးအစားကိုထုတ်ယူနည်း

PHP ဖွံ့ဖြိုးတိုးတက်မှုတွင်ကျွန်ုပ်တို့သည် debugging လုပ်ငန်းစဉ်တွင်အထူးအရေးကြီးသည့် variable အမျိုးအစားကိုကျွန်ုပ်တို့မကြာခဏဆုံးဖြတ်ရန်လိုအပ်သည်။ PHP သည် variable များ၏ data type အချက်အလက်များရရှိရန်အတွက်အသုံးပြုနိုင်သည့် built-in functtype () ကိုထောက်ပံ့ပေးသည်။

GetType () function ကို၏အခြေခံအသုံးပြုမှု

GetType () သည် variable အမျိုးအစားရရန်အသုံးပြုသော function တစ်ခုဖြစ်သည်။ Return Value သည် variable အမျိုးအစားကိုညွှန်ပြသည့် string တစ်ခုဖြစ်သည်။ ဤလုပ်ဆောင်မှုသည် application sceripation အတွက် application patriods များအတွက်အလွန်လက်တွေ့ကျသည်။

နမူနာကုဒ်

 
<?php
$name = "John Doe";
echo gettype($name); // ထုတ်လုပ်ခြင်း:string
?>

GetType () အမျိုးအစားဖော်ပြချက်ကိုပြန်ပို့သည်

ဤလုပ်ဆောင်ချက်သည်အောက်ပါအမျိုးအစားအမည်များကိုပြန်ပို့နိုင်သည်။

  • ကြိုး
  • ကိန်း
  • float (နှစ်ဆအဖြစ်ဖော်ပြနိုင်သည်)
  • Booleean
  • အခင်းအကျင်း
  • ကန့်ကွက်
  • ပစ္စည်းအင်းအား
  • တရားစွာလဲှ

ဥပမာအားဖြင့်:

 
<?php
$number = 100;
echo gettype($number); // ထုတ်လုပ်ခြင်း:integer

$flag = true;
echo gettype($flag); // ထုတ်လုပ်ခြင်း:boolean

$data = null;
echo gettype($data); // ထုတ်လုပ်ခြင်း:NULL
?>

မှတ်သားရန်အရာ

  • GetType () သည် variable အမျိုးအစားကိုသာပြန်လည်ရောက်ရှိစေပြီး variable ၏တန်ဖိုးကိုထုတ်ပေးသည်မဟုတ်။
  • အရာဝတ်ထုများအတွက်၎င်းသည်ကွန်ကရစ်အတန်းအစားအမည်မပြဘဲ "အရာဝတ်ထု" ကိုသာပြန်လာလိမ့်မည်။
  • အကယ်. variable ကိုမသတ်မှတ်ထားပါက (သို့) NULL ကိုမဖော်ပြပါကပြန်လည်နေရာချထားခြင်းသည် "null" ဖြစ်သည်။
  • ဤလုပ်ဆောင်ချက်သည် Debugging တွင်အသုံးပြုရန်အတွက်အသုံးပြုရန်အကောင်းဆုံးဖြစ်သည်။

အကျဉ်းချုပ်

GetType () ကို အသုံးပြုခြင်းသည်အမျိုးမျိုးသောတရားသူကြီးများကိုလျင်မြန်စွာတရားစီရင်ရန်ကူညီနိုင်သည်။ အထူးသဖြင့်ပြောင်းလဲနေသောစာရိုက်သည့်ဘာသာစကားများကြောင့်ဖြစ်ပေါ်လာသောဆွေးနွေးမှုအခက်အခဲများနှင့်ရင်ဆိုင်ရသောအခါ၎င်းသည်သတင်းအချက်အလက်များကိုအလိုအလျောက်ဖြစ်ပေါ်စေသည့်နည်းလမ်းကိုပေးပြီး PHP developer တိုင်းသည်ကျွမ်းကျင်သင့်သောအခြေခံကိရိယာတစ်ခုဖြစ်သည်။